Colonial home, built 1978. Three bedrooms, four bathrooms, 2,482 sq ft on 1.19 acres in Loudon, TN 37774. Luxury vinyl plank floors.

Upstairs, the open-concept kitchen, dining, and living area creates a warm and welcoming centerpiece for the home. The kitchen features granite countertops by Granite Transformations, installed over the original countertops, along with a ceramic tile backsplash and high-quality solid hickory cabinetry. Additional framing was installed in the ceiling to provide secure support for the upper cabinetry. LVP flooring flows throughout the main level, complemented by crown molding, updated trim, fresh interior paint, numerous LED fixtures, and faux wood window blinds throughout much of the main living area. The primary suite provides comfortable main-level living with a walk-in closet and private bath featuring a five-foot step-in shower, fold-down bench, handheld showerhead, rain-style showerhead, body-massage jets, and grab bars. The primary bath also includes an elevated ADA-height toilet with bidet attachment. The hall bath offers another five-foot step-in shower with built-in bench and grab bars, along with a double-sink vanity. ADA-height toilets are installed throughout the home. A third full bath off the laundry room means never having to bring that ''work dirt'' into the main living areas, while a fourth full bath downstairs with Marbled PVC panels (which are waterproof and mold resistant!) adds even more flexibility and convenience. Whether used as a third bedroom, recreation room, hobby area, or workshop, the downstairs provides an impressive amount of additional living, working, and storage space. The walkout basement greatly expands the home's possibilities with its oversized flex space, workshop area, private bath, extensive storage, and wide commercial-grade metal doors opening to the rear yard. Just off the main living area, the four-season-style sunroom features marble flooring, a metal security-style exterior door, and solar shades providing approximately 95% light filtering. From there, step onto the expansive rear balcony with ramp access and enjoy an inviting place to relax, entertain, or simply take in the surrounding countryside and mountain views. Additional highlights include a durable metal roof, Simonton argon-gas replacement windows throughout most of the main level, and a hardwired DVR security system with six exterior cameras. Spectrum internet and cable service are available. The property also offers a large front yard, an open garage already framed for the future addition of a garage door, and a separate storage building. Located in the Philadelphia area of Loudon County, the property offers a peaceful country setting while remaining within convenient reach of surrounding communities and amenities.
